RTX 2060 Super Max-Q vs HD 7750: which should you choose?

RTX 2060 Super Max-Q — NVIDIA laptop graphics card (2019, Turing) with 8 GB of GDDR6, averaging 17 fps at 1440p.

HD 7750 — AMD desktop graphics card (2012, GCN 1.0) with 1 GB of GDDR5, averaging 11 fps at 1440p; launched at $109.

RTX 2060 Super Max-Q vs HD 7750: RTX 2060 Super Max-Q is faster for gaming. RTX 2060 Super Max-Q averages 17 fps at 1440p versus 11 fps — about 55% faster. HD 7750 draws less power (55W vs 78W).

1080p, 1440p and 4K

At 1440p — the most common enthusiast resolution — the RTX 2060 Super Max-Q averages 17 fps against 11. At 4K (9 vs 5 fps) VRAM (8GB vs 1GB) and memory bandwidth matter more.

Power and value

Board power is 78 W versus 55 W, which affects PSU headroom, case cooling and noise.

Methodology

Graphics cards are compared on 3DMark Time Spy scores, average gaming frame rates at 1080p/1440p/4K, FP32 compute throughput, VRAM capacity and type, memory bandwidth, board power (TDP) and launch MSRP — plus AI workload throughput (Stable Diffusion iterations/s and local LLM tokens/s) where measured. Vintage and server GPUs without modern benchmark results are compared on specifications only, clearly labelled. Frame rates are averages across a game suite at high settings; specific titles vary.
